在大规模系统中怎么扩展Cassandra集群

在大规模系统中,要扩展Cassandra集群可以采取以下几种方法:增加节点:可以通过增加新的节点来扩展Cassandra集群。新节点可以加入现有的集群,并参与数据的存储和处理,从而提高整个系统的容量和性能。水平扩展:Cassandra是一个分布式数据库,支持水平扩展。可以通过增加更多的节点和分片来水平扩展集群的能力,从而实现更大规模的存储和处理。数据中心扩展:如果集群已经跨越多个数据中心,则可以通

在大规模系统中,要扩展Cassandra集群可以采取以下几种方法:

  1. 增加节点:可以通过增加新的节点来扩展Cassandra集群。新节点可以加入现有的集群,并参与数据的存储和处理,从而提高整个系统的容量和性能。

  2. 水平扩展:Cassandra是一个分布式数据库,支持水平扩展。可以通过增加更多的节点和分片来水平扩展集群的能力,从而实现更大规模的存储和处理。

  3. 数据中心扩展:如果集群已经跨越多个数据中心,则可以通过在新的数据中心部署更多的节点来扩展集群。这样可以提高系统的容错性和可用性。

  4. 优化数据模型:在扩展集群之前,可以对数据模型进行优化,以减少数据冗余和提高查询性能。优化数据模型可以减少数据存储和传输的开销,从而提高系统的整体性能。

  5. 负载均衡:在扩展集群后,需要确保负载均衡工作正常,避免某些节点过载而导致系统性能下降。可以通过负载均衡器来分配请求到不同的节点,以实现负载均衡。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/943988.html

(0)
派派
上一篇 2024-03-19
下一篇 2024-03-19

相关推荐

  • 什么是双线空间(双空间是什么意思)

    什么是双线空间,双空间是什么意思内容导航:双线空间个四线空间有什么区别价格一样的吗一次元指的是什么双线空间是什么意思网络常识中什么是双线空间一、双线空间个四线空间有什么区别价格一样的吗双线空间就是说他所在机房是两条线路接入,一般会是电信网通线路接入四线空间也就是四线线路接入机房,电信,网通,教育网,铁通等都有

    2022-05-02
    0
  • linux怎么获取root权限

    在Linux系统中,可以通过以下几种方式获取root权限:使用sudo命令:在命令前加上sudo,然后输入密码即可临时获取root权限执行该命令。例如:sudo command切换到root用户:可以使用su命令切换到root用户,然后输入root密码即可获取永久的root权限。例如:su -设置sudo免密码:可以通过编辑sudoers文件来允许某个用户或用户组在不输入密码的情况下使用sudo命

    2024-04-22
    0
  • c语言如何解方程

    在C语言中,可以使用不同的方法来解方程。以下是其中的一些方法:迭代法:使用迭代的方法逐步逼近方程的解。例如,可以使用二分法、牛顿法或者其他迭代算法来求解方程。数值法:将方程转化为数值问题,使用数值计算方法来求解。例如,可以使用数值积分、数值求根等方法来求解方程。符号计算法:将方程转化为符号表达式,使用符号计算库来求解。例如,可以使用Mathematica、Maple等符号计算软件来求解方程。矩阵法

    2024-01-18
    0
  • 「手机应用设计属于什么专业」设计手机的专业

    手机应用设计属于什么专业,设计手机的专业内容导航:手机设计报什专业手机设计制造属于什么专业还是属于应用经济学数学与应用数学专业属于基础专业吗一、手机设计报什专业手机设计包括如下几个专业:如果你是要设计整个手机,就报《工业设计》专业。如果你要做手机的元器件,比如电路,cpu什么的,那就报《集成电路设计与集成系统》《微电子技术》等等。如果你是想做手机的软件,就报《计算

    2022-05-11
    0
  • c语言实现汉诺塔的步骤是什么

    汉诺塔问题是一个经典的递归问题,其解决步骤如下:定义一个递归函数来实现汉诺塔问题的解决,函数的原型为 void hanoi(int n, char A, char B, char C),其中 n 表示盘子的数量,A、B、C 表示三根柱子。在函数内部,首先判断如果只有一个盘子,则直接移动该盘子到目标柱子上。若盘子数量大于一个,则需要将上方 n-1 个盘子从 A 移动到 B,然后将最底下的一个盘子从

    2024-02-21
    0
  • mybatis typehandler自定义的方法是什么

    MyBatis TypeHandler 是一个用于处理数据库类型和 Java 类型之间转换的工具,它可以自定义方法来实现特定的转换逻辑。自定义 TypeHandler 需要实现 org.apache.ibatis.type.TypeHandler 接口,并重写其中的方法。以下是 TypeHandler 接口中的一些常用方法:setParameter(PreparedStatement ps, i

    2024-01-28
    0

发表回复

登录后才能评论